How to pick the right app in Charm City

  • Neighborhood density: Look for matches clustering around Mount Vernon, Federal Hill, Canton, Hampden, Fells Point, and the Inner Harbor.
  • Prompt styles: Apps that use detailed prompts or questionnaires help you stand out in a city known for personality and humor.
  • Filters that matter: Intent, lifestyle, politics, pets, and neighborhoods save you endless swipes.
  • Verification: ID checks, selfie video, and badge systems cut catfishing.
  • Community features: Interest groups for food, books, live music, or Orioles and Ravens fans create easy intros.
  • Discovery beyond swiping: Event boards, audio notes, and passport-style location browsing widen your net.
  • Value: Free tiers are fine; upgrade only if you need priority visibility, advanced filters, or unlimited likes.

Baltimore-specific tips that boost matches

Lean into the city’s character-quirky, creative, and neighborly. Show where you hang out and what you love about it.

  • Neighborhood signalers: Patterson Park jogs, Hampden coffee crawls, Mount Vernon galleries, Station North murals.
  • Waterfront wins: Fells Point strolls, Canton boardwalk photos, quiet corners by piers.
  • Food and culture: Farmers markets, crab cakes allegiance, BMA and Walters snapshots.
  • Sports icebreakers: Orioles cap or Ravens purple in one photo for instant conversation starters.
  • Campus-friendly angles: Hopkins labs, med campus commutes, or Charles Village bookstores-without oversharing exact locations.
Show your neighborhood personality, not your full itinerary.

FAQ

  • Which apps have the most Baltimore users?

    Mainstream swipe platforms generally show the largest pools around central neighborhoods like Mount Vernon, Federal Hill, Canton, and Fells Point. If you prefer depth over volume, try compatibility-forward apps and compare match quality rather than raw counts.

  • How can I reduce ghosting?

    Lead with a local-specific opener, add one clear plan suggestion, and ask a choice-based question. Keep messages short, avoid generic compliments, and match the other person’s pacing and tone.

  • Are paid upgrades worth it?

    They can be if you need advanced filters, priority visibility, and undo features. Try free first, note your bottleneck (views, likes, replies), then upgrade only for tools that directly fix that bottleneck.

  • What photos work best in the city?

    Use a bright candid, a clear full-body, and a local environment shot-think waterfront, parks, murals, or a favorite cafe. Avoid group shots that hide your face and over-filtered edits.

  • How do I date safely in Baltimore?

    Meet in public spaces, share your plan with a trusted contact, use in-app calling until comfortable, verify profiles via photo or video badges, and trust your instincts if details feel inconsistent.
